※ 本記事にはアフィリエイトリンクが含まれています。
は、AI機能を搭載したコードエディタです。従来のエディタとは異なり、AIがコード生成からリファクタリングまで支援し、開発者の生産性を大幅に向上させます。
この記事で分かること
- Cursorの実際の評判・口コミ
- 料金プランと他エディタとの比較
- 具体的な導入・活用方法
Cursorとは?

Cursorは、OpenAIのGPT-4をベースとしたAI機能を統合したコードエディタです。アメリカのAnysphere社が2022年に開発し、現在世界中で50万人以上の開発者が利用しています。
従来のエディタとの最大の差別化ポイントは、「コード生成だけでなく、既存コードの理解・改善・説明まで一括でAIが対応」することです。GitHub Copilotが主にコード補完に特化しているのに対し、Cursorはプロジェクト全体の文脈を理解し、より高度な開発支援を提供します。
主な特徴
- GPT-4ベースのAIによる高精度なコード生成・補完
- 自然言語での指示によるコード修正・リファクタリング
- プロジェクト全体の文脈を理解したインテリジェントな提案
- VS Codeとの高い互換性(拡張機能・設定の引き継ぎ可能)
- 日本語を含む多言語での質問・指示に対応
主要機能の詳細解説
Tab機能(AI Code Completion)
Tab機能は、開発者がコードを書きながらリアルタイムでAIが次の行を予測・提案する機能です。単純な補完を超え、コメントや関数名から意図を汲み取り、複数行にわたる実装を自動生成します。
例えば、「// ユーザー認証機能を実装」とコメントを書くと、JWT トークンの生成からバリデーション処理まで、完全な認証ロジックが数秒で生成されます。従来のエディタでは数十分かかる実装も、平均して大幅な短縮が可能です。
Chat機能(Conversational Programming)
Chat機能では、エディタ内でAIと自然言語で対話しながらコードを開発できます。「このバグを修正して」「パフォーマンスを改善して」といった指示を日本語で送ると、AIが該当箇所を特定し、修正案を提示します。
具体的には、複雑なSQL クエリの最適化や、レガシーコードのモダン化など、高度な技術判断が必要な作業も、AIとの対話を通じて段階的に改善していけます。他のコードエディタにはない、コンサルティング的な開発支援が最大の強みです。
Cmd+K機能(Inline Code Generation)
Cmd+K機能は、コード内の任意の箇所で AIに直接指示を出せる機能です。選択したコード範囲に対して「この部分をTypeScript に書き換えて」「エラーハンドリングを追加して」と指示すると、その場で修正版が生成されます。
例えば、JavaScript で書かれた関数を選択し、「async/await を使った非同期処理に変更」と指示すると、Promise ベースのコードが即座にモダンな記法に変換されます。コードレビューの指摘事項も、数秒で対応完了できます。
Composer機能(Multi-File Editing)
Composer機能は、複数ファイルにまたがる大規模な変更をAIが一括で実行する機能です。「新しいAPIエンドポイントを追加」「データベーススキーマの変更に伴うコード更新」など、プロジェクト全体に影響する修正を、一度の指示で完了させられます。
通常であれば数時間かかるリファクタリング作業も、関連するファイル群を自動で特定し、整合性を保ちながら一括更新します。大規模プロジェクトほど、生産性向上の効果が顕著に現れます。
料金プラン
| プラン | 月額料金 | 主な機能 | 利用制限 |
|---|---|---|---|
| Hobby | 無料 | 基本的なAI補完、限定的なGPT-4アクセス | 月200回のGPT-4リクエスト |
| Pro | $20/月 | 無制限のAI機能、高速な応答速度 | GPT-4無制限、優先サポート |
| Business | $40/月 | チーム機能、管理者コントロール | 全Pro機能 + チーム管理 |
| Enterprise | 要相談 | カスタム統合、オンプレミス対応 | 企業向けセキュリティ機能 |
各プランの対象者
- Hobby: 個人開発者・学習目的
- Pro: フリーランス・小規模チーム
- Business: 中小企業の開発チーム
- Enterprise: 大企業・セキュリティ要件が厳しい組織
年払いを選択すると約17%の割引(Pro プランなら月額$17相当)が適用されます。無料プランでも基本機能は十分に試せますが、GPT-4の利用制限があるため、本格的な開発には Pro プラン以上が推奨されます。
まずは無料のHobbyプランで2週間ほど試用し、AIの精度と自分の開発スタイルとの相性を確認してからPro プランへの移行がおすすめです。
具体的な使い方・操作手順
1. アカウント登録とセットアップ
目的: CursorでAI機能を利用するための初期設定を完了します。
にアクセスし、右上の「Download for Free」ボタンをクリック。Mac、Windows、Linux版をダウンロード後、インストーラーを実行します。初回起動時に GitHub または Google アカウントで認証を完了し、既存の VS Code 設定がある場合は「Import from VS Code」を選択して設定を引き継ぎます。
Tip: VS Code の拡張機能や設定は自動的に同期されるため、移行にかかる時間は通常5分以内です。
2. プロジェクトの読み込みとAIへの文脈提供
目的: AIがプロジェクト全体を理解し、的確な提案をできるように環境を整えます。
メニューから「File → Open Folder」で開発中のプロジェクトフォルダを選択します。初回読み込み時に、Cursor が自動的にプロジェクトの構造とコードベースを解析し、AIの文脈データベースに登録します。大規模プロジェクトの場合、解析完了まで数分かかることがありますが、この工程により後の AI支援の精度が大幅に向上します。
3. Tab機能でのコード補完を活用
目的: 日常的なコーディング作業でAI補完を最大限活用します。
新しい関数やクラスを作成する際、関数名やコメントを入力後に Tab キーを押すとAIの提案が表示されます。提案が適切であれば Tab で受け入れ、修正が必要な場合は部分的に編集できます。例えば「function calculateTax(」まで入力すると、引数の型定義から税額計算のロジックまで自動生成されます。
注意点: 提案を受け入れる前に、セキュリティ面やプロジェクトの設計方針に沿っているかを必ず確認しましょう。
4. Chat機能で複雑な問題を解決
目的: AIとの対話を通じて、設計レベルの課題や複雑なバグを解決します。
画面左側の「Chat」パネルを開き、「このコードのパフォーマンスを改善する方法を教えて」「エラーハンドリングを追加したい」などの質問を日本語で入力します。AIは該当するコードファイルを参照しながら、具体的な改善案とコード例を提示します。提案が気に入った場合は「Apply」ボタンで直接コードに反映できます。
5. Cmd+K機能で部分的なコード変更
目的: 既存コードの特定箇所を効率的に修正・改善します。
修正したいコード範囲を選択し、Cmd+K(Windows では Ctrl+K)を押します。表示されるテキストボックスに「TypeScript に変換」「async/await を使用」「コメントを追加」などの指示を入力すると、選択範囲のみが指示に従って変更されます。変更前後の差分が表示されるため、意図しない修正を防げます。
Tip: 複数の修正候補が提示された場合は、矢印キーで選択肢を確認し、最適なものを選んでください。
6. Composer機能で大規模変更を実行
目的: 複数ファイルにまたがる機能追加や大幅なリファクタリングを効率化します。
画面右側の「Composer」パネルから「新しい機能を追加したい」旨を詳細に説明します。例えば「ユーザー管理機能を追加。登録・ログイン・プロフィール編集を含む」と入力すると、関連するすべてのファイル(ルーティング、コントローラー、ビューなど)を自動生成・修正します。大規模な変更の場合は段階的に実行され、各ステップで確認を求められます。
7. 生成されたコードの検証とテスト
目的: AI が生成したコードの品質と動作を確認し、実用レベルに仕上げます。
生成されたコードは必ず動作テストを実行し、プロジェクトの既存コードとの整合性をチェックします。Chat機能で「このコードのユニットテストを作成して」と依頼すると、適切なテストケースも自動生成されます。問題が見つかった場合は、具体的なエラー内容をAIに報告し、修正版を生成してもらいます。
活用事例・ユーザーの声
G2のレビュー(2026年4月時点)では、100件のレビューが投稿されており、総合評価は4.7/5.0です。
活用シーン1:主な利用パターン(G2レビュー傾向より)
G2のレビューでは、コードベース全体を理解したAI提案が高く評価されています。 デバッグ・リファクタリングが高速化も頻繁に言及されています。
活用シーン2:導入効果(G2レビュー傾向より)
G2のレビューでは、IDEにAIが深く統合による業務効率化が報告されています。
活用シーン3:導入時の注意点(G2レビュー傾向より)
G2のPros & Consでは、Pro $20/月で重量ユーザーには追加課金リスクが改善要望として挙げられています。
G2ユーザー評価: 4.7/5.0(100件のレビュー、2026年4月時点)
高評価ポイント: コードベース全体を理解したAI提案 改善要望: Pro $20/月で重量ユーザーには追加課金リスク
— G2レビューページで実際のユーザーの声をご確認いただけます
メリット・デメリット
メリット
- ✓ 圧倒的なコード生成精度: GPT-4ベースでコンテキストを理解した高品質なコード生成
- ✓ VS Code完全互換: 既存の開発環境をそのまま移行でき、学習コストがほぼゼロ
- ✓ 多言語対応: JavaScript/Python/Java など50以上の言語で高精度な支援
- ✓ プロジェクト全体理解: 単体コードではなく、アーキテクチャレベルでの提案が可能
- ✓ リアルタイム協調: AIとペアプログラミングのような感覚で開発を進行
デメリット
- ✗ 月額コストが高め: Pro プランで月$20と、無料エディタと比較すると負担が大きい
- ✗ インターネット接続必須: オフライン環境では AI機能が完全に利用不可
- ✗ 生成コードの検証が必要: AIの提案をそのまま使用すると、セキュリティや設計上の問題が生じる可能性
- ✗ 大規模プロジェクトでの応答速度: 数万ファイルのプロジェクトでは、コンテキスト解析に時間がかかる場合がある
- ✗ 日本語ドキュメント不足: 公式ドキュメントは英語のみで、日本語の情報源が限定的
競合ツールとの簡易比較
| 項目 | Cursor | GitHub Copilot | CodeWhisperer |
|---|---|---|---|
| 月額料金 | $20 | $10 | $19 |
| エディタ統合 | 専用エディタ | VS Code拡張 | 複数エディタ対応 |
| コード生成精度 | ★★★★★ | ★★★★ | ★★★ |
| 日本語対応 | ◯ | △ | △ |
| プロジェクト理解 | ★★★★★ | ★★ | ★★ |
使い分けガイド
- 本格的なAI開発支援が欲しい場合: Cursor(プロジェクト全体を理解した提案)
- 既存のVS Code環境を変えたくない場合: GitHub Copilot(拡張機能として追加)
- AWS環境での開発が中心の場合: CodeWhisperer(AWS サービスとの連携が強力)
よくある質問(FAQ)
Q. 日本語での質問や指示に対応していますか?
A. はい、完全対応しています。Chat機能では日本語での質問に対して適切な回答とコード例を提供し、Cmd+K機能でも「この関数を日本語でコメントして」などの指示が通ります。生成されるコメントや変数名も、日本語と英語を適切に使い分けてくれます。
Q. 無料プランでどこまで利用できますか?
A. Hobby プランでは基本的なコード補完(Tab機能)は無制限で利用でき、GPT-4を使用した高度な機能(Chat、Composer)は月200回まで利用可能です。個人の学習や小規模なプロジェクトであれば、無料プランでも十分実用的です。
Q. 解約方法や返金ポリシーはどうなっていますか?
A. アカウント設定から「Billing」セクションで即座に解約でき、解約月の月末まで有料機能を利用できます。返金については、サービス開始から30日以内であれば全額返金が可能です。年払いプランの場合は、未使用月数分の日割り返金に対応しています。
Q. セキュリティやデータ保護は大丈夫ですか?
A. コードデータは暗号化されてOpenAI のサーバーに送信されますが、学習データとしては使用されません。Enterprise プランでは、オンプレミス展開やプライベートクラウド環境での運用も可能です。機密性の高いプロジェクトでは、設定で特定のファイルや行をAI解析の対象外にすることもできます。
Q. 他のツールやサービスとの連携はできますか?
A. Git、GitHub、GitLab との連携は完全対応しており、プルリクエストの生成やコミットメッセージの自動生成も可能です。また、Docker、AWS、Firebase などの主要なクラウドサービスとの統合コードも生成できます。VS Codeの拡張機能もほぼ全て利用可能です。
Q. 導入にかかる時間はどの程度ですか?
A. 既存のVS Code環境がある場合、設定の移行を含めて15分程度で利用開始できます。新規の場合でも、ダウンロードからプロジェクトの読み込み完了まで30分程度です。大規模プロジェクトの場合、AI による初回解析に追加で10-30分程度かかる場合があります。
まとめ:Cursorはコード品質と開発速度を両立したい方におすすめ
- AI支援の精度:GPT-4ベースでプロジェクト全体を理解した高品質なコード生成
- コストパフォーマンス:月$20で得られる時間短縮効果を考慮すれば十分にペイ
- 最適な利用者:中級者以上の開発者、品質重視のプロジェクト、技術学習を加速したい方
参考・情報ソース
この記事の情報は2026年4月時点のものです。最新の料金プランや機能については、各サービスの公式サイトをご確認ください。
まずは無料で体験
Cursor を無料で試してみる
無料プランあり・3分で登録完了